Commission paid to foreign agent not regarded as fees for technical services u/s. 9(1)(vii)

November 25, 2023 2991 Views 0 comment Print

ITAT Delhi held that foreign commission paid by the assessee to its foreign agent for arranging of export sales and recovery of payment could not regarded as fees for technical services under section 9(1)(vii) of the Act. Accordingly, disallowance of expenditure u/s. 40(a)(i) unjustified.
